With its entrenched reputation for high-end M&A across a host of sectors, Slaughter and May has a strong focus on the infrastructure market, with digital and renewable assets forming the cornerstone of the blockbuster deals it regularly advises on. The depth and breadth of the practice’s bench allows the team to advise on large-scale transactions for global industry titans, advising on holding company sales, business reorganisations and carve-outs that require integral corporate, financing, and construction expertise.  Considerable global reach is also displayed through the team's advice in energy deals across India, Africa and notably the Middle East - a jurisdiction where the group advised Blackrock on a multi-billion dollar equity stake in Saudi Aramco. Team head Michael Corbett is an M&A specialist, boasting impressive credentials overseeing complex cross-border transactions initiated by infrastructure and energy funds and strategics, as well as wielding a wealth of experience dealing with governmental and public bodies. Hywel Davies advises on a wide array of M&A, joint ventures and corporate restructurings, with a strong focus on energy and infrastructure mandates in Europe. Oly Moir has shown an impressive level of activity over recent months, working on mandates for a number of the team's key clients, with a far-reaching skillset that is especially concentrated on traditional and renewable energies. Iain McCann and Daniel Mewton also come recommended.

Work highlights

  • Advised BlackRock Real Assets (“BlackRock”) on a consortium investment of approximately USD 525million for a stake of between 9.76% and 11.43% in Tata Power Renewable Energy Limited (“Tata Power Renewables”), one of the largest renewable energy companies in India.
  • Advised UK Infrastructure Bank in relation to its £200 million debt investment as a cornerstone lender in the largest digital debt transaction in the UK market. The deal, which is worth £4.9billion in total, supports a programme which marks a step-change in the acceleration of full fibre broadband across the UK to meet Government targets.
  • Advised Ferrovial S.A. and its group companies on:  the sale of Amey plc; the reorganisation of its waste services business; and the sale of its utility services business.
